On Tenerife they call this The Finger of God, and to anyone who has ever visited the island it is a wellknown symbol, to be found in the middle of the national park around the volcano El Teide that you also see in the background. The National Park is in fact an enormous crater 2000 meters above sea level and El Teide that rises 3712 meters above sea level is the only still active volcano. A walk in the national park is like a walk in Grand Canyon coupled with a visit to Iceland, and the entire area is an altogether mystical and unique place. And it gets quite cold in spite of being so far south because of the altitude.

The air is very clear, so photographers have it easy and this shot was only resized and very slightly enhanced before uploading.
